Hearing the scream, Dale ran down the stairs looking for the source, reaching a long corridor that seemed to stretch with no end towards darkness. Stained walls, broken tiles on the floor and an unsettling mist made for an appropriate decoration. He could still hear the screams, but there was something else.
Whispers.
He couldn’t understand what was being said, but the ominous noise reminiscent of horror movies was there as if an unseen crowd was around him. Running along the corridor, he soon noticed something strange. Neither the screams nor the whispers changed in intensity as he moved. The end of the corridor was still out of view.
Without time to waste, Dale thought about his previous experiences and concluded. It usually triggered by itself, but he decided to experiment.
EXCLUSIVE SKILL TRACE OF INSANITY ACTIVATED
The whispers ceased, he still couldn’t see the end of the corridor, but the feeling of infinity was gone. The screams now had a clear source and Dale ran towards it worried about the others, stopping in front of a decaying door. Opening it, Dale was confronted with a despairing situation.
In the middle of the room, Kyle was unconscious on the from with a wound on his head. In a corner of the room, Nina seemed to be holding Hazel’s hand. When his eyes adapted to the lighting, he realized she was struggling to keep a hold of Hazel.
From that same corner, sprouting from a hole on the floor were several vine-like appendages wrapped around Hazel’s body, pulling her towards the hole. Both women were trying their best to hold on, but it didn’t seem the struggle would last much longer. Seeing some of the tentacles sneaking behind Nina, Dale dashed forward and arrived just in time to slash them with his sword, making a loud thud. These vines felt a lot sturdier than the creature’s from the rooftop.

Startled by the noise, Nina’s grip waned and Hazel was rapidly dragged down. Before Nina had the chance to throw herself forwards, Dale grabbed her and jumped back. At the same time, the remaining vines attacked all at the same time in an attempt to grab them both and barely failed. It seemed they couldn’t stretch further. Biting her lips and realizing getting caught wasn’t the solution, Nina stopped struggling and tried to calm down.
— What happened here? — Dale asked while checking on Kyle.
— We were looking for a place to recover and got attacked by that thing. Kyle was struck and Oliver was dragged right before you arrived. I knew you had a plan to deal with that creature, but if we knew you’d do it so fast, we would’ve stayed with you.
With a confused look on his face, Dale retorted.
— What do you mean fast? I was with that thing for at least half an hour. Is that fast?
Nina replied with an incredulous expression — Half an hour? What are you talking about? We’ve just left… Fuck, this place is messing with our minds too.
— I think so. Before we think about the next step, we have to get out of this room. Help me with Kyle.
Without wasting time, Nina helped Dale support the unconscious Kyle and they left the room.
— I gather you have a way to get us out of this corridor? — Asked Nina.
— Something like that — Answered Dale. After getting rid of the whispers, the doors that previously looked the same now appeared distinct. Looking for the least weathered door, Dale settled on a room and opened it. Inside it, they found several rows of tables and chairs, a layout you’d find in any school.
Advertisement
After checking for vines and other threats, they laid Kyle on the ground and Dale proceeded to address his wound. Cleaning it with some water from the bag they received, Dale noticed it was smaller than when they were in the previous room.
— I guess he won’t need help.
— He probably has high vitality — Said Nina.
Dale agreed. He realized it after his battle on the rooftop. His strained muscles recovered much faster than he expected. It most likely had to do with the “System”.
— You seem to know a bit about this place. You didn’t seem surprised by Amy’s explanation.
— I know enough to get by — Nina looked at Dale with deep meaningful eyes — We’ve been planning to come here for a while.
Before Dale could ask what she meant, Kyle finally moved.
— What happened? Is everyone alright? — Remembering what happened, Kyle got nervous after seeing there were only three of them.
Nina explained what happened, how Hazel and Oliver were dragged, and how Dale arrived and they reached the current room.
— The others were taken? — Kyle looked at Nina and lowered his head — I’m sorry, if I had been more careful I would’ve been able to help.
— Don’t worry, we’ll get them back — Said Nina.
— Are they still alive? — Kyle asked surprised by how calm Nina looked.
— That seems to be the case — Said Dale — Judging by how it knocked you out, if that thing wanted to kill them, it wouldn’t need to drag them down. They’re probably trapped somewhere. We might not have a lot of time, but there’s still hope.
— Exactly — Exclaimed Nina. She look at Dale and proceeded — Dale, isn’t it? It looks like you have a way of navigating this place. Can I count on you to help?
— Yes, in exchange, I’d like your help with the rest of this introduction mission.
— The rest of the mission?
— Considering my experience with that thing on the rooftop, I don’t think we’ll be able to fight those things individually using wooden swords. Like we thought before the mission started, we’ll have to help each other if we want to survive.
Nina and Kyle looked at Dale trying to guess what sort of battle had transpired, without knowing it was mostly him running around and dodging for an inch of his life.
— So, are you guys in? — Asked Dale.
— Yes — Both answered without hesitation.
— Well then. Let’s prepare for the rescue mission.
